Description

8vo., First Edition, with 34 plates on 16; blue cloth, gilt back, a very good, bright, clean copy in unclipped dustwrapper. The second collaboration by a team with an established reputation for combining successfully history and personal recollection. This is the story of the Royal Navy Patrol Service, whose extemporised fleet of trawlers, drifters and whale-catchers fought in virtually every naval theatre of WWII. Based largely on eye-witness accounts, this is the first dedicated account and already very scarce, the more so in this condition. Enser, p.427; Law, 1105.
